The six-car train was traveling from Philadelphia to Wilmington when it caught fire around 6 p.m. Thursday near the Crum Lynne Station in Ridley Park.
Around 6 p.m., a fire was reported under a Wilmington/Newark Line train near Crum Lynne Station, an agency spokesperson said.
No injuries have been reported after a fire on a SEPTA train in Ridley Park forced about 350 people to evacuate.
